#a17954 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#a17954 is composed of 63.1% red, 47.5%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 24.8% magenta, 47.8% yellow and 36.9% black. It has a hue angle of 28.8 degrees, a saturation of 31.4% and a lightness of 48%. #a17954 color hex could be obtained by blending #fff2a8 with #430000. Closest websafe color is: #996666.

Shades and Tints of #a17954

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060503 is the darkest color, while #fcfaf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#a17954

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7b7a7a is the less saturated color, while #ec7609 is the most saturated one.
